Evaluation Question 4
a) Refer to the audience research you
undertook.

The audience for my acoustic magazine according to Young and


Rubicam would be the reformers. They value their own independent
judgement and are the most anti-materialistic of the 7 groups, and
are often perceived as intellectual. The age range would be 15+,
teens and young adults maybe up to 30. The gender would mainly be
girls because it is calmer and "more mature". They tend to be in the
B/C1 socio-economic class because the acoustic genre is a mature
vibe, which appeals to the higher class. Acoustic has a Niche
audience, which is a minority group, select group of people that have
a unique interest. For example, collectors of salt and peppershakers
that are shaped like bears.

c) Refer to some audience theories to define
your audience.

By looking at Maslows hierarchy of needs I believe my magazine


fulfils two sections: love and belonging and esteem. Firstly
love and belonging because it enables people to connect with
each other and be part of the group: the magazine will help
people to believe that theres people with similar interests to
them. Secondly esteem because it will offer them confidence
based on the good opinions of others.
